#include <nss.h>
#include <netdb.h>
#include <ctype.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<libc-lock.h>
#include <rpcsvc/yp.h>
#include <rpcsvc/ypclnt.h>
#include "nss-nis.h"
__libc_lock_define_initialized (static, lock)
struct intern_t
{
bool_t new_start;
char *oldkey;
int oldkeylen;
};
typedef struct intern_t intern_t;
static intern_t intern = {TRUE, NULL, 0};
static enum nss_status
internal_nis_setservent (intern_t * intern)
{
intern->new_start = 1;
if (intern->oldkey != NULL)
{
free (intern->oldkey);
intern->oldkey = NULL;
intern->oldkeylen = 0;
}
return NSS_STATUS_SUCCESS;
}
enum nss_status
_nss_nis_setservent (void)
{
enum nss_status status;
__libc_lock_lock (lock);
status = internal_nis_setservent (&intern);
__libc_lock_unlock (lock);
return status;
}
static enum nss_status
internal_nis_endservent (intern_t * intern)
{
intern->new_start = 1;
if (intern->oldkey != NULL)
{
free (intern->oldkey);
intern->oldkey = NULL;
intern->oldkeylen = 0;
}
return NSS_STATUS_SUCCESS;
}
enum nss_status
_nss_nis_endservent (void)
{
enum nss_status status;
__libc_lock_lock (lock);
status = internal_nis_endservent (&intern);
__libc_lock_unlock (lock);
return status;
}
static enum nss_status
internal_nis_getservent_r (struct servent *serv, char *buffer,
size_t buflen, intern_t *data)
{
char *domain;
char *result;
int len, parse_res;
char *outkey;
int keylen;
char *p;
if (yp_get_default_domain (&domain))
return NSS_STATUS_UNAVAIL;
/* Get the next entry until we found a correct one. */
do
{
enum nss_status retval;
if (data->new_start)
retval = yperr2nss (yp_first (domain, "services.byname",
&outkey, &keylen, &result, &len));
else
retval = yperr2nss ( yp_next (domain, "services.byname",
data->oldkey, data->oldkeylen,
&outkey, &keylen, &result, &len));
if (retval != NSS_STATUS_SUCCESS)
{
if (retval == NSS_STATUS_TRYAGAIN)
__set_errno (EAGAIN);
return retval;
}
if (len + 1 > buflen)
{
free (result);
__set_errno (ERANGE);
return NSS_STATUS_TRYAGAIN;
}
p = strncpy (buffer, result, len);
buffer[len] = '\0';
while (isspace (*p))
++p;
free (result);
parse_res = _nss_files_parse_servent (p, serv, buffer, buflen);
if (!parse_res && errno == ERANGE)
return NSS_STATUS_TRYAGAIN;
free (data->oldkey);
data->oldkey = outkey;
data->oldkeylen = keylen;
data->new_start = 0;
}
while (!parse_res);
return NSS_STATUS_SUCCESS;
}
enum nss_status
_nss_nis_getservent_r (struct servent *serv, char *buffer, size_t buflen)
{
enum nss_status status;
__libc_lock_lock (lock);
status = internal_nis_getservent_r (serv, buffer, buflen, &intern);
__libc_lock_unlock (lock);
return status;
}
enum nss_status
_nss_nis_getservbyname_r (const char *name, char *protocol,
struct servent *serv, char *buffer, size_t buflen)
{
intern_t data = {TRUE, NULL, 0};
enum nss_status status;
int found;
if (name == NULL || protocol == NULL)
{
__set_errno (EINVAL);
return NSS_STATUS_UNAVAIL;
}
status = internal_nis_setservent (&data);
if (status != NSS_STATUS_SUCCESS)
return status;
found = 0;
while (!found &&
((status = internal_nis_getservent_r (serv, buffer, buflen, &data))
== NSS_STATUS_SUCCESS))
{
if (strcmp (serv->s_name, name) == 0)
{
if (strcmp (serv->s_proto, protocol) == 0)
{
found = 1;
}
}
}
internal_nis_endservent (&data);
if (!found && status == NSS_STATUS_SUCCESS)
return NSS_STATUS_NOTFOUND;
else
return status;
}
enum nss_status
_nss_nis_getservbyport_r (int port, char *protocol, struct servent *serv,
char *buffer, size_t buflen)
{
intern_t data = {TRUE, NULL, 0};
enum nss_status status;
int found;
if (protocol == NULL)
{
__set_errno (EINVAL);
return NSS_STATUS_UNAVAIL;
}
status = internal_nis_setservent (&data);
if (status != NSS_STATUS_SUCCESS)
return status;
found = 0;
while (!found &&
((status = internal_nis_getservent_r (serv, buffer, buflen, &data))
== NSS_STATUS_SUCCESS))
{
if (htons (serv->s_port) == port)
{
if (strcmp (serv->s_proto, protocol) == 0)
{
found = 1;
}
}
}
internal_nis_endservent (&data);
if (!found && status == NSS_STATUS_SUCCESS)
return NSS_STATUS_NOTFOUND;
else
return status;
}
